High-quality mild steel plate with a carbon content below 0.25%, engineered for general structural use, fabrication and welded assemblies where good formability and reliable mechanical performance are required.
Key features
- Carbon ≤ 0.25% for good ductility, weldability and formability.
- Suitable for construction, structural components, fabrication, welded assemblies and general engineering applications.
- Produced by hot rolling or by flattening from coil for widths up to 2.0 m — enabling rapid delivery for common plate sizes.
- Plates of 2.5 m width or greater are produced by hot rolling; typical lead time is approximately 25 days for these larger widths.
Availability & lead times
- Widths up to 2.0 m: available via hot rolling or coil flattening — short delivery times for standard sizes.
- Widths 2.5 m and above: produced only by hot rolling; plan for longer lead times (about 25 days).
